ABOUT THE RABBIT BREEDS
CALIFORNIAN
The Californian rabbit breed is known for their distinctive color pattern with a white body and dark points on the nose, ears, feet, and tail. They are medium-sized rabbits with a gentle and friendly temperament, making them popular as pets and show animals. Originally developed in California in the 1920s, Californians are prized for their meat production and fur quality, making them a versatile breed for both commercial and domestic purposes.

DUTCH
The Dutch rabbit breed is known for its distinctive markings of a colored body with a white band encircling it, as well as its playful and friendly nature. Originating in the Netherlands, these medium-sized rabbits have a compact, rounded body with upright ears. Dutch rabbits make popular pets due to their affectionate temperament and ease of handling. With a lifespan of 5-8 years and a variety of color combinations, the Dutch breed is a favorite among rabbit enthusiasts worldwide.

FLEMISH GIANT
The Flemish Giant rabbit is a gentle giant of the rabbit world, known for its massive size and sweet temperament. Originating in Belgium, these rabbits can weigh up to 22 pounds and have a distinctive appearance with their large ears and muscular bodies. Despite their imposing size, Flemish Giants are docile, friendly, and make great pets for both experienced and first-time rabbit owners. With their calm demeanor and easygoing nature, they are a popular choice for families looking for a lovable and low-maintenance rabbit companion.

LIONHEAD
The Lionhead rabbit breed is known for its distinctive mane of wool encircling its head, resembling that of a lion. Characterized by their small size, charming demeanor, and playful nature, Lionheads make excellent pets for both families and individuals alike. These rabbits come in a wide range of colors and patterns, with their distinguishing feature being the wool mane that requires regular grooming. With their friendly and social personalities, Lionhead rabbits are popular among rabbit enthusiasts seeking a lovable and unique companion.

NEW ZEALAND
The New Zealand rabbit breed is known for its sturdy build, commercial value, and gentle temperament. With its distinct red, white, black, and blue color varieties, this breed is popular among both beginners and experienced rabbit enthusiasts alike. New Zealands are prized for their efficient meat production, good maternal instincts, and adaptability to various climates, making them a versatile choice for rabbit breeders looking for a hardy and reliable animal.
